Warre's Otima 20 Yr Old Tawny - Bottled 2004
Tasted chilled - Toffee nose and a lovely thick texture. Very smooth and sweet with a butterscotch taste and no heat whatsoever. Finish is long and warming. Leaves the cheeks watering.
